    Xavez reacted to MEB in Designer: Expand stroke is completely broken   
    Hi SteveMose,
    Welcome to Affinity Forums
    No updates yet. The dev teams were/are all quite busy and this is not something quick to fix.
    In some cases increasing the scale of the objects, expading them, then scaling them down again to their original size might help.
    I'm sorry for the inconvenience this is causing you. We are working as fast as possible to address the issues reported but due to limited dev resources/time some things will require more time than others.

    Xavez reacted to R C-R in Scroll to and highlight active layer in layers list   
    Xavez, you probably already know about this, but if you have selected something in a layer, if you right-click on it to pop up the contextual menu, the last item on that menu is "Find in layers Panel," which will scroll the layers panel to its layer, expanding as necessary to show it if it is a collapsed child layer.
     
    Not quite what you want but it can be a real timesaver for documents that have lots of layers.
